我已经在visual basic2010上成功地在npgsql中执行了SQL命令,但是现在我很难弄清楚如何做一个分页的数据网格视图。
谁有一个非常简单的例子,在visual studio (visual Basic2010)中使用一个简单的datagridview on form,使用npgsql链接到一个大型的datatable?
假设有一个名为users的表,其中有5个字段和数百万行。
我知道通常你不会想让用户滚动数百万行,应该提供过滤功能,但我希望能够显示一个datagridview (具有我可以处理的表单上的过滤选项),如果用户向下滚动,则只加载所需的记录。
我的问题是没有从哪里开始的线索,我看过MS示例,但它们不使用npgsql,并且我不知道npgsql在这方面是如何工作的。
因此,一个使用npgsql的分页数据网格视图的简单示例将是一个巨大的帮助-一旦我知道了npgsql等中的基本命令,我就可以根据需要对其进行扩展/更改。
这只是一个学习实验--我不喜欢把所有行都加载到内存中的datagridview的想法--它是不可扩展的……
发布于 2012-06-14 13:05:35
算了,算出来了。
我没有注意到
Npgsql.NpgsqlDataAdapter()
这使得使用MS示例成为可能,并对其余信息进行修改以满足个人需求。
https://stackoverflow.com/questions/11010828
复制相似问题